What to Expect
Pharmaceutical production jobs in Nijmegen generally involve shift work, with typical hours spanning from 8 to 40 hours per week, depending on the company and role. Shifts may include early mornings, evenings, or nights, which is common in manufacturing. Physical demands can include standing for long periods, manual handling of small components, and attention to hygiene and safety standards. Working environments are clean, controlled, and often require wearing protective clothing such as lab coats, gloves, and masks. Although physically demanding, these roles provide a structured routine, and most workers report a positive team atmosphere.

Requirements
To work in a pharmaceutical production facility in Nijmegen, you typically need basic English skills and the right to work in the Netherlands. Most employers prefer candidates with a good work ethic and an interest in the industry. Previous experience is not always essential, as many companies provide training. Important documents include a valid ID or passport, a BSN (Dutch citizen service number), and proof of residence or work permit if applicable. A clean criminal record may be required for certain positions due to the sensitive nature of pharmaceutical products. Ensuring you have the necessary documents ready will streamline the application process.

Salary & Benefits
In 2026, the minimum wage in the Netherlands for workers aged 21 and above is €14.71/hour. Pharmaceutical factory roles typically offer similar or higher wages, often ranging from €15 to €20/hour, depending on experience and shift type. Overtime work may increase earnings further. Benefits usually include paid leave, health insurance, and adherence to collective labor agreements (CAO). Many employers also provide assistance with housing, transport, or meal allowances. Working in the Netherlands guarantees stable employment, with rights protected under Dutch labor laws, including sick leave and holiday pay. Curious about your earning potential?
